Explain the concept of disaster management and discuss the role of technology in enhancing disaster response and mitigation.
Disaster management plays a crucial role in minimizing the impact of natural and man-made disasters. Explore the concept of disaster management and highlight the significance of technology in improving disaster response and mitigation strategies.
- Disaster management refers to the process of planning, coordinating, and implementing measures to respond to and mitigate the impact of disasters.
- It involves four phases: prevention, preparedness, response, and recovery.
- Technology plays a key role in enhancing disaster response and mitigation:
- - Early warning systems: Technology enables the timely detection and prediction of disasters, allowing authorities to issue alerts and evacuate people at risk.
- - Remote sensing and GIS: Satellite imagery and Geographic Information Systems help in mapping and analyzing disaster-prone areas, aiding in effective planning and resource allocation.
- - Communication and coordination: Technologies like mobile apps and social media allow real-time communication and coordination between responders, enabling rapid response and efficient resource mobilization.
- - Data analysis and prediction: Big data analytics and machine learning can analyze vast amounts of data to predict disaster patterns, enabling better planning and targeted interventions.
- - Rescue and relief operations: Drones and robotics assist in locating and rescuing people in disaster-stricken areas, enhancing the speed and safety of operations.
- - Rehabilitation and recovery: Technology supports post-disaster reconstruction and recovery efforts through tools like remote sensing, 3D printing, and virtual reality.
